How Ofrex 120 Tablet works:
Histamine antagonist Ofrex 120mg tablets counteract the inflammatory effects of histamine, a substance that triggers itching, redness, swelling, and irritation.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Alcohol consumption alongside Ofrex 120 Tablet lacks established safety data. Physician consultation is advised.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Using Ofrex 120 Tablet during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escription. Physician consultation is advised.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Ofrex 120 Tablet presents minimal risk during breastfeeding. Research in humans indicates negligible drug transfer into breast milk, posing no apparent threat to the infant. The low concentration in breast milk and absence of drowsiness suggest Ofrex 120 Tablet use is unlikely to harm breastfed infants.
DrivingSAFE
Driving ability is typically unaffected by Ofrex 120 Tablet. Nevertheless, prior to driving or operating machinery, confirm that you are not experiencing drowsiness or dizziness as a result of taking Ofrex 120 Tablet.
KidneyCAUTION
Individuals with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Ofrex 120 Tablet.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Patients with advanced kidney disease may experience pronounced drowsiness.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Ofrex 120 Tablet in individuals with liver impairment is likely safe. Current evidence indicates dose modification may not be necessary, but physician consultation is recommended.
What if you forget to take Ofrex 120 Tablet :
Should you forget to take your Ofrex 120 Tablet, administer it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
